What I Look For in a Spare Dog Bed Cover
For me, the most important things are fit, fabric, and durability. I always make sure the cover matches the size and shape of my dog bed so it doesn’t slip or bunch up. I also prefer materials that are soft for my dog but strong enough to handle regular washing and daily use.
Choosing the Right Material
I usually pay close attention to the fabric. If I want something easy to clean, I go for machine-washable materials like polyester blends or canvas. If comfort is my priority, I look for soft fleece or cotton. For dogs that scratch or chew, I find tougher fabrics work better because they hold up longer.
Checking the Closure Type
I always check how the cover closes. Zippers are my favorite because they keep the cover secure and make it easy to remove. Some covers use Velcro or envelope-style openings, but I personally prefer zippers since they feel more reliable for everyday use.
Making Sure It Fits Properly
Fit is one thing I never overlook. I measure my dog bed before buying a spare cover, including length, width, and thickness. A good fit keeps the bed comfortable and prevents the cover from shifting around when my dog gets in and out.
Considering Easy Maintenance
I like covers that are simple to wash and dry. Since dog beds can get dirty fast, I always check whether the cover can go in the washing machine. Quick-drying covers are especially helpful when I need to put the bed back together the same day.
Thinking About Style and Color
Even though comfort comes first, I still like choosing a cover that looks nice in my home. I usually pick colors or patterns that hide fur and stains well. Darker shades and textured fabrics often work best for me because they stay looking cleaner between washes.
